把数学说成是美丽的看来是一种常识。数学家常对他们所做的表现出满足和快乐。他们常常宣称定理、证明、方法乃至理论可以是优雅的和漂亮的。同样,说数学家中间存在着天才也是一种常识。然而,康德对这两个问题都改变了观点。直到18世纪80年代,我们还发现他接受数学里有美和天才的作用。但他随后就好像改了主意。从他在18世纪80年代到90年代的作品中我们发现他或明或暗地说过,美和天才的概念不应该被用于数学,而应被限制在仅用于艺术。这不仅仅与我们今天大多数人的说法相矛盾,而
